powered by simpleCommunicator - 2.0.61     © 2026 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/ Проектирование БД [игнор отключен] [закрыт для гостей] / Длинная таблица + архив VS множество маленьких архивных таблиц
4 сообщений из 4, страница 1 из 1
Длинная таблица + архив VS множество маленьких архивных таблиц
    #33995386
Alexey B.
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Извините, что немного повторюсь, но помоему это как раз тема для этого топика

Сервер: Firebird

Не знаю как лучше сделать:
1. Одну таблицу с объемом до 5 миллионов + неограниченную таблицу только для чтения как архивную
в рабочей таблице фактически идет работа с очень малым процентом записей (1%), но работа частая

2. много маленьких таблиц с разбивкой по интервалам, в которых идет активная работа, т.е. примерно по 5000 в каждой

1 подход более удобен в реализации и сопровождении, но меня гложит мысль, что во втором подходе я получу ощутимую прибавку в скорости, хотя и в БД будут накапливаться сотни таблиц

Под интенсивной работой я понимаю пакетное удаление порядка от 10 до 5000 записей и такую же вставку (update не происходит)

Помогите, пожалуйста развеять мои сомнения, может прибавки в скорости не будет :-?
...
Рейтинг: 0 / 0
Длинная таблица + архив VS множество маленьких архивных таблиц
    #33995567
AsPiro
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Мало того что таблицу поделить задумал, так ещё и кросспостингом балуешься...
Шалунишка:)

I Live Again!
...
Рейтинг: 0 / 0
Длинная таблица + архив VS множество маленьких архивных таблиц
    #33995651
barsukof
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Можеть подобрать индекс по активному рабочему интервалу?
Alexey B.
Под интенсивной работой я понимаю пакетное удаление порядка от 10 до 5000
Сколько мсек идет DELETE ? INSERT?
Какие требования по отклику на DELETE-INSERT?
Может все-таки заменить на UPDATE?
Скоко записей в активном рабочей части таблицы ?
Сколько записей надо хранить в архиве?
Если есть DELETE ,то как Вы пакуете базу?
...
Рейтинг: 0 / 0
Длинная таблица + архив VS множество маленьких архивных таблиц
    #33995866
Alexey B.
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
почитал /topic/263975&pg=2
сделал выводы :)
...
Рейтинг: 0 / 0
4 сообщений из 4, страница 1 из 1
Форумы / Проектирование БД [игнор отключен] [закрыт для гостей] / Длинная таблица + архив VS множество маленьких архивных таблиц
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]